Manjay isn't just a restaurant — it's a celebration of Caribbean culture on a plate. Christian Dominique joins us to break down how he built one of Miami's most unique food concepts, what makes his honey jerk chicken so legendary, and why the fusion of Haitian, Dominican, and West African flavors resonates so deeply with Miami's diverse community.He covers the full menu, bestsellers, delivery apps, the role influencers played in growing the brand, whether food or service matters more, and how Doral has changed since he opened there.
